WebOn your Mac, click the Finder icon in the Dock to open a Finder window, then click Network in the Locations section of the sidebar.. If no items appear in the Locations section of the sidebar, hold the pointer over the word Locations, then click the arrow .. In the Finder window, double-click the computer you want to connect to, then click Connect As. camper walden bootsWebOn your Mac, click the Finder icon in the Dock to open a Finder window, then click Network in the Locations section of the sidebar.
